Ticket: Staging env misconfigured for Siftgate bloom filter

The bloom layer in front of the Pellet KV store is rejecting all lookups in staging because the env file was copied from the dev template without credentials. False-positive tuning values are fine; only the auth line is missing. To unblock the weekly demo, the Pellet admission secret must be set on the following line.

env line for yaguf-fajop: LEDGER_TOKEN13=fb08984397349

This snippet covers the Inkmill markdown rendering pipeline. Raw posts land in the parse queue, get sanitized by Scrubjay, then rendered to HTML by the Inkmill workers. If rendering backs up, restart the worker pool via the deploy script. The script pushes a signed bundle to the render fleet, so you will need the deploy key that follows:

release key, fajef-kajeg: bky19_LdLu6Ne6FLi8he2c24d

INTERNAL MEMO — Sales Leads

Re: Marketing budget reduction

Effective next month, the marketing budget is reduced by 18%. Trade-show spend is cut first; the Alderwick expo is cancelled. Digital campaigns for the Pellora range continue at reduced frequency. Lead volumes will dip; adjust pipeline forecasts accordingly and flag any at-risk accounts to Hetty by Friday. Co-marketing funds with partners are frozen pending review. This is not a hiring signal — roles are unaffected. The rationale is set out in the confidential note below.

board note of kagep-yahig: Only 9 of the 120 pilot accounts renewed Quenix, so a churn review is set for April 1.

**Action item (P1):** Autocomplete index on Quillseek rebuilt nightly; p99 latency hit 900ms during the Tuesday incident because shard fanout was unbounded. Owner: on-call. Cap fanout, raise the prefix cache TTL, and lower the rebuild batch size before next Thursday's traffic spike. Verify with the synthetic query harness in staging, then roll to the Verlane cluster first. Do not touch merge policy. The constants to apply are listed below.

constants for tafog-kahag:
RATE_LIMITS = {
    "sorir": 697,
    "oliox": 683,
    "holax": 176,
    "casox": 60,
    "pelius": 382,
}